| ; We previously had a case where we would put results from a no-args call in |
| ; its own stratified set. This would make cases like the one in @test say that |
| ; nothing (except %Escapes and %Arg) can alias |
| |
| ; RUN: opt < %s -disable-basicaa -cfl-steens-aa -aa-eval -print-all-alias-modref-info -disable-output 2>&1 | FileCheck %s |
| |
| ; CHECK: Function: test |
| ; CHECK: NoAlias: i8* %Arg, i8* %Escapes |
| ; CHECK: MayAlias: i8* %Arg, i8* %Retrieved |
| ; CHECK: MayAlias: i8* %Escapes, i8* %Retrieved |
| define void @test(i8* %Arg) { |
| %Noalias = alloca i8 |
| %Escapes = alloca i8 |
| call void @set_thepointer(i8* %Escapes) |
| %Retrieved = call i8* @get_thepointer() |
| ret void |
| } |
| |
| declare void @set_thepointer(i8* %P) |
| declare i8* @get_thepointer() |
